# Florida SB 804 (2021) — Substance Abuse Services
Substance Abuse Services; Providing criminal penalties for making certain false representations or omissions of material facts when applying for service provider licenses; requiring the Department of Children and Families to suspend a service providers license under certain circumstances; expanding the applicability of certain exemptions for disqualification to applications for certification of a recovery residence or a recovery residence administrator, respectively; specifying that certain dwellings converted to recovery residences do not have a change of occupancy under the Florida Building Code due to such conversion, etc.
**Enacted** — Laws of Florida, Chapter 2021-128.

##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2021-01-26** Filed `filing`
- **2021-02-04** Referred to Children, Families, and Elder Affairs; Community Affairs; Rules `referral-committee`
- **2021-02-25** On Committee agenda-- Children, Families, and Elder Affairs, 03/02/21, 4:00 pm, 37 Senate Building
- **2021-03-02** Introduced `introduction`
- **2021-03-02** CS by Children, Families, and Elder Affairs; YEAS 8 NAYS 0
- **2021-03-03** Pending reference review under Rule 4.7(2) - (Committee Substitute)
- **2021-03-05** Now in Community Affairs
- **2021-03-10** CS by Children, Families, and Elder Affairs read 1st time
- **2021-03-19** On Committee agenda-- Community Affairs, 03/24/21, 8:30 am, 37 Senate Building
- **2021-03-24** CS/CS by Community Affairs; YEAS 8 NAYS 0
- **2021-03-24** Pending reference review under Rule 4.7(2) - (Committee Substitute)
- **2021-03-25** CS/CS by Community Affairs read 1st time
- **2021-03-29** Now in Rules
- **2021-04-13** On Committee agenda-- Rules, 04/16/21, 9:00 am, 412 Knott Building
- **2021-04-15** On Committee agenda-- Rules, 04/20/21, 8:30 am, 412 Knott Building
- **2021-04-16** Favorable by- Rules; YEAS 16 NAYS 0 `committee-passage-favorable`
- **2021-04-16** Placed on Calendar, on 2nd reading
- **2021-04-16** Placed on Special Order Calendar, 04/21/21
- **2021-04-21** Read 2nd time `reading-2`
- **2021-04-21** Read 3rd time `reading-3`
- **2021-04-21** CS passed; YEAS 40 NAYS 0 `passage`
- **2021-04-21** In Messages
- **2021-04-23** Bill referred to House Calendar
- **2021-04-23** Bill added to Special Order Calendar (4/26/2021)
- **2021-04-23** 1st Reading (Committee Substitute 2)
- **2021-04-26** Read 2nd time `reading-2`
- **2021-04-26** Placed on 3rd reading
- **2021-04-26** Added to Third Reading Calendar
- **2021-04-27** Read 3rd time `reading-3`
- **2021-04-27** CS passed; YEAS 115, NAYS 0 `passage`
- **2021-04-27** Ordered enrolled
- **2021-04-27** Message sent to senate
- **2021-06-16** Signed by Officers and presented to Governor
- **2021-06-21** Approved by Governor `executive-signature`
- **2021-06-23** Chapter No. 2021-128
